To ensure student success, K-12 leaders must examine elements such as the effectiveness of intervention strategies, the influence of a student’s socioeconomic background on their success, and differences in discipline among various student groups. Even though these questions can be challenging to answer, they’re profoundly important.

This white paper will dive into five critical questions K-12 leaders must ask about student progress including:

  1. What is the trend in reading and math performance over the last 3 years?
  2. Are my students receiving reading intervention beginning to close the gap with their peers?
  3. Which students are not progressing toward college and career readiness?
  4. Are there differences in student achievement based on socioeconomic status?
  5. Are discipline rates similar between English Language Learners (ELLs) and non-ELLs?
